#e29686 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e29686 is composed of 88.6% red, 58.8%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.6% magenta, 40.7%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 10.4 degrees, a saturation of 61.3% and a lightness of 70.6%. #e29686 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c52d0d.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#e29686 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e29686 has RGB values of R:226, G:150, B:134 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.41,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14849670.
